Berries tend to have a good nutritional profile. Eating them regularly may help prevent and reduce the symptoms of many chronic diseases

Some berries, however, stand out for their health benefits. So, here are the 8 healthiest berries you can consume daily

Blueberries are rich in antioxidants and brain-boosting power. They can lower the risk of heart disease, type 2 diabetes and neurological decline

Raspberries are high in fibre and antioxidants. They also contain manganese, which is necessary for healthy bones and skin and helps regulate blood sugar

Goji berries contain high levels of vitamin A and zeaxanthin, which are important for eye health, immunity, and energy

Strawberries' high levels of vitamin C and other antioxidants help reduce the risk of serious health conditions like cancer, diabetes, stroke and heart disease

Cranberries are a good source of antioxidants and fibre. They offer a range of health benefits, including preventing UTIs, promoting heart health, and boosting immunity

Acai berries are high in healthy fats and antioxidants. They can improve brain function, protect against prostate cancer, boost heart health and enhance skin health

Bilberries contain several plant compounds that can help fight inflammation, improve heart health, prevent diabetes, reduce the risk of cancer, and more

Grapes are a good source of antioxidants and various vitamins and minerals. They help boost heart health, manage blood pressure, protect the eyes, and more
